What Is an IT Training Course?

An IT training course is a structured program designed to teach various aspects of information technology. These courses range from beginner to advanced levels and cover topics like networking, cybersecurity, software development, cloud computing, and more. They can be delivered online, in-person, or as a hybrid, offering flexible learning options to fit your schedule.

The goal of an IT training course is to equip learners with practical skills, certified knowledge, and a competitive edge in the technology job market.

Popular Topics Covered in IT Training Courses

Depending on your interests and career goals, IT courses can focus on various specialties, such as:

  • Networking fundamentals (CCNA, CompTIA Network+)
  • Cybersecurity principles (Certified Ethical Hacker, CISSP)
  • Cloud computing (AWS, Azure, Google Cloud)
  • Software development (Python, Java, C#, Full-Stack)
  • Data analysis and AI (Data Science, Machine Learning)
  • DevOps and automation tools (Docker, Jenkins, Kubernetes)
  • Database management (SQL, NoSQL, Oracle)

Many courses also prepare participants for industry-recognized certifications, which can significantly enhance job prospects.

How to Choose the Right IT Training Course

When selecting an IT training program, consider the following:

  • Course Content & Outcomes: Make sure it aligns with your career goals and provides practical skills.
  • Instructor Credentials: Check the instructor's industry experience and certifications.
  • Format & Flexibility: Online, classroom, or hybrid options; self-paced or scheduled classes.
  • Cost & Certifications: Compare prices and whether the course offers industry-recognized certifications.
  • Reviews & Reputation: Look for feedback from previous learners to gauge quality and effectiveness.
